How they compare
Chile currently reports 0.2141 against 0.2041 in Switzerland, a difference of 0.01.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 5 shared years of data; in 2009 it was Switzerland ahead.
Chile ranks 51st and Switzerland ranks 52nd of 63 countries.
Switzerland has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
